There are trees to be seen in Ladakh but these prominent willows and poplars (species of SALIX and species of POPULUS) which have been planted along water-courses since at least the 19th Century to provide shade, fodder and building material, are almost all ALIEN species. Running in a generally northwest to southeast direction through Ladakh, the great Himalayan Range separates the valley of Kashmir from Ladakh.
